Malaysian PE buys Tremendous Peking Duck chain

Fashionable Singapore restaurant chain Tremendous Peking Duck seems to be set for accelerated worldwide enlargement.

In response to Bloomberg, Malaysian personal fairness agency Navis Capital Companions has agreed to purchase the model’s Singapore proprietor, Imperial Treasure Restaurant Group.

The corporate has paid between S$60 and $80 million for a majority stake within the enterprise and plans to speed up the model’s rollout in China.

Imperial Treasure was based in 2004 by Alfred Leung who will retain his curiosity and proceed to be concerned with the enterprise. It now has 23 eating places specialising in Chinese language meals and owns a positive eating restaurant at Marina Bay Sands, overlooking the gaming flooring.

Leung is also referred to as the founding father of Crystal Jade Culinary Ideas, bought to the LVMH Group final yr, netting round $100 million.

In line with Bloomberg, the deal and phrases are confidential and neither celebration wished to remark additional on the transaction.

Navis final week purchased Malaysian sweet and snackfood enterprise Cocoaland Holdings.
